The ISCAR 5902384 is a laydown threading insert designed for external UN thread cutting at 24 threads per inch (TPI). Built from solid carbide with a TiAlN PVD coating and ISCAR IC908 manufacturer grade, this insert delivers wear resistance and thermal stability during threading operations on a wide range of workpiece materials. The insert features a 3/8 inch (0.3750 inch decimal) inscribed circle, a thickness of 0.143 inches, and a right-hand cutting orientation. It is part of the ISCARTHREAD series and carries an M chipbreaker designation. Machinists and CNC operators performing external threading on lathes and turning centers install this insert as a direct-fit replacement in compatible ISCAR toolholders.
This insert is suited for external UN thread applications in both production and job-shop turning environments. The IC908 grade with PVD coating performs across a universal range of workpiece materials including steels, stainless steels, cast irons, non-ferrous alloys, and high-temperature alloys, reflected in its material grade designations C1, C2, C6, and C7 and workpiece material codes H, K, M, N, P, and S. Typical applications include threading on CNC lathes producing standard UN fastener threads at 24 TPI in medium to high production runs.
Designed as an OEM-style replacement laydown threading insert for use in ISCARTHREAD series external threading toolholders accepting the 16ER insert style with a 3/8 inch inscribed circle.
This insert is installed and replaced by a machinist or CNC toolroom technician. Disengage the machine spindle and confirm the turret is fully stopped before seating or replacing the insert. Use the appropriate torx or clamping key specified for the toolholder to secure the insert to the correct seating torque per the toolholder manufacturer documentation. Inspect the insert seat and clamping surfaces for chips or debris before installation to ensure proper insert contact and thread profile accuracy.
